Hitler's phone sold for $243,000 at US auction

 

A telephone used by Adolf Hitler during World War Two has been sold for $243,000 (£195,744) at a US auction.

 

The identity of the buyer, who bid by phone, has not been revealed. The bidding in Chesapeake City, Maryland, started at $100,000.

 

The red phone, which has the Nazi leader's name engraved on it, was found in his Berlin bunker in 1945.
